These teams are core to the success of our business and will be responsible for administering, tuning, and scaling our Java-based web application and infrastructure. The system is deployed on RedHat Enterprise Linux, CentOS, and Windows 2003 Servers running IIS 6.0, Apache 2.0 & 2.2, Tomcat 5.5, and Oracle 10g, in both virtualized and non-virtualized environments. The Senior Systems Administrator will be responsible for both system administration and software maintenance and support -- running the day-to-day administration of the production and staging environments as well as participating in development efforts. This includes hardware, network, server, and database sizing, monitoring, scaling, troubleshooting, planning, backups, as well as participation in the analysis, design, and implementation of new features and enhancements. *Required* The ideal candidate will meet most of the following criteria: 1. Benefits include paid vacation and holidays, medical and dental plan, and matching 401(k). *About GovDelivery* GovDelivery, Inc. is the leading digital communication provider for the public sector. Its flagship product, GovDelivery DSM, is the world's premiere digital subscription management system designed specifically for the public sector. It empowers organizations to provide citizens with better service and access to relevant information by proactively delivering new information through email, wireless alerts, and RSS. GovDelivery is used by over two hundred public sector organizations worldwide, including the FBI, Centers for Disease Control, Social Security Administration, U.S. Departments of Defense, Labor, State, Agriculture, Transportation, and Commerce; U.K. Parliament; Washington, D.C.; Orange County, CA; the cities of St. Paul and Minneapolis (MN). These public sector organizations send millions of targeted email messages using GovDelivery every month. In the past year, the company has doubled its client base and grown its workforce by over 60% to keep pace with its rapidly growing client base. GovDelivery is one of the fastest growing software companies in the Twin Cities of Minneapolis and St. Paul. The company received the Minneapolis St. Paul Business Journal's Fast 50 award in 2006 and 2007, an award given to the 50 fastest-growing private companies in the Twin Cities.
